Possible

Possible adjective - Existing only as a possibility and not in fact.
Usage example: only one of several possible outcomes

True is an antonym for possible.

Nearby Words: possibility, possibly

True

True adjective - Existing in fact and not merely as a possibility.
Usage example: the true scope of this environmental problem is far greater than anyone imagined

Possible is an antonym for true.
